Mary Kamene, who was taken to Uganda by her biological father at the age of five in 1998, has finally reunited with her family in Kajiado County after 27 years.

Kamene, now in her early thirties, had lived in Busia, Uganda, since childhood and was raised by her grandmother following the death of her father shortly after their move.

For nearly three decades, Kamene had not set foot in her birthplace, and her family had given up hope of ever seeing her again.

The emotional reunion, which took place this week, was marked by tears of joy and heartfelt embraces as family members welcomed her back home.

“I feel like a part of me that was missing has finally returned,” said one of her relatives during the emotional gathering.

Kamene shared that although she grew up away from home, she always felt a longing to reconnect with her roots. With the help of local leaders and good Samaritans, she managed to trace her family in Kenya.
